Barium is an element in group 2, period 6 of the periodic table. What does this indicate about its properties?

Barium (Ba) is an alkaline earth metal located in group 2 and period 6 of the periodic table. The position of barium in this group and period provides insights into its properties:

  1. Group Characteristics: As a member of group 2, barium shares certain characteristics with other alkaline earth metals, such as:

    • Valence Electrons: Barium has two valence electrons in its outermost shell. This makes it relatively reactive, although less so than the alkali metals in group 1.
    • Chemical Reactivity: Barium readily loses its two valence electrons to form a +2 oxidation state, resulting in compounds such as barium oxide (BaO) and barium chloride (BaCl₂). It reacts with water, albeit more slowly than some lighter alkaline earth metals, producing barium hydroxide and hydrogen gas.
    • Metallic Properties: It is shiny, silvery-white, and has a relatively low melting point for a metal. It also exhibits typical metallic characteristics such as ductility and malleability.
  2. Period Characteristics: Being in period 6 indicates that barium has additional electron shells compared to lighter elements in the same group:

    • Atomic Size: Barium is larger than its lighter alkaline earth metal counterparts due to the increased number of electron shells. This leads to overall greater atomic radius and lower ionization energy, making it easier for barium to lose electrons.
    • Density and Mass: Barium is one of the heavier alkaline earth metals; it has a high atomic mass and density compared to its group members.
  3. Chemical and Physical Properties:

    • Reactivity with Acids: Barium can readily react with acids to form barium salts and hydrogen gas.
    • Compounds: Barium forms various compounds, including barium sulfate (BaSO₄), which is used in medical imaging, and barium carbonate (BaCO₃), which has applications in ceramics and glass.
    • Flame Color: When burned, barium salts produce a greenish color in flames, making it useful in pyrotechnics.

Overall, the position of barium in group 2 and period 6 suggests that it is a reactive, metallic element with distinct physical and chemical properties, reflecting the characteristics typical of alkaline earth metals.
